What affects the price

When planning a hardscape project, several factors influence the total investment. The type of materials you select—whether natural stone, concrete pavers, or permeable options—plays a significant role. The scope of work, including site preparation, excavation, and existing landscape removal, also impacts the bottom line. Projects involving complex patterns, curves, or integrated features like fire pits and retaining walls require more labor and time. What are the benefits of paver patios over stamped concrete in Phoenix?

Paver patios offer distinct advantages over stamped concrete in Phoenix. Pavers allow for easier repairs if one becomes damaged. They also offer a wider range of design and color options. Licensed installers ensure proper drainage, crucial in our climate. Pavers can provide a more natural look, complementing desert landscaping.

What outdoor patio furniture works best with paver patios in Phoenix?

Outdoor patio furniture that withstands Phoenix heat and sun is best. Wicker, metal, and treated wood furniture are good choices. Consider lighter colors to reflect heat. Ensure furniture placement doesn't obstruct drainage. A well-designed paver patio can support various furniture styles for comfortable outdoor living.
